Transaction 59276ec9497c3269499937aa3bc14933aeb99f1cd108b65a429409eb035bd59c

1 Input
2 Outputs
  • 59276ec9497c3269499937aa3bc14933aeb99f1cd108b65a429409eb035bd59c:0
  • value  804572109
    address  1vtL7XYhj2GsVcPkYu4Yy2cixovoLqkyK
  • 59276ec9497c3269499937aa3bc14933aeb99f1cd108b65a429409eb035bd59c:1
  • value  1999980000
    address  12ENymUcfgNyHFtPqenrkmgig563Q1bb5G